How are your exhausts made?
All of Cobra exhausts are made from aircraft grade 304
stainless steel and constructed using precision TIG welding with mandrel
formed bends in the pipe work for a smoother gas flow. Cobra pride
ourselves in producing high quality products.

What power gains can I expect to achieve?
Of course this varies from engine to engine, our
systems are designed and manufactured to maximize gas flow with
increased diameter pipe work, free flowing silencers and mandrel bends
which provide a much less restrictive exhaust system than original
equipment exhausts, resulting in a much better engine response and
increased BHP. Typically you can expect to achieve around a 10% increase
from the installation of a cat-back system. Some individual products
also show approximate power gains.
Is it legal to put a de-cat pipe on my car?
You can only de-cat your car if it was registered
prior to 1992, otherwise it will fail the emissions check at your MOT
station. Cobra de-cats sold for cars after this year are intended for
off-road use only.
Will my car need remapping?
If you are fitting a cat back system to your car, this
will have no effect on the engine management operations. However, if
you are replacing your original system with a de-cat, sports cat or
front pipe your car may need remapping as it may cause the vehicles
engine management light to activate.
What is the difference between resonated and non-resonated systems?
Resonators are box chambers incorporated into the
exhaust system, which are used to make the exhaust quieter, by
cancelling certain sound frequencies. A non-resonated exhaust system
will therefore, give a louder exhaust note and a resonated exhaust
system, a quieter exhaust note. Either option will still provide extra
performance.
What is a Slash-Cut tailpipe?
Slash-cut tailpipes are finished and cut off at a 15
degree angle, and suit certain types of vehicles depending upon the
shape of the bumper and overall aesthetics of the vehicle. If you
require any advice on which tailpipe would be most appropriate for your

How do I keep my exhaust looking like new?
If you do not clean your exhaust/tailpipe, it will
eventually become discoloured and be more difficult to bring back to its
original finish. Regular cleaning with a non-abrasive metal polish such
as Solvol Autosol® will ensure that your exhaust continues to look as
new.
